
Yarn Chen contributed to the Tencent/tdesign family of repositories by building and refining modular UI components and release workflows that improved deployment reliability and user experience. Working across tdesign-react and tdesign-vue, Yarn delivered features such as ESM-enabled chat packages, resizable dialogs, and enhanced icon systems, while also addressing cross-framework issues in form handling, date/time selection, and asset delivery. Using TypeScript, React, and Vue.js, Yarn focused on maintainable code, robust documentation, and scalable build systems. The work demonstrated depth in API design, internationalization, and CI/CD, resulting in more predictable releases and a consistent, accessible design system for developers.

October 2025 (2025-10) — Delivered deployment reliability improvements, CDN-based asset delivery, and new UI capabilities across the TD Design family. The work spanned Flutter, Vue, React, MiniProgram, and API components, with a focus on business value through reliable previews, scalable production asset delivery, and improved developer experience via docs and deployment config updates. Major outcomes include stabilizing the preview deployment workflow, introducing interactive UI primitives, and standardizing production asset paths across web and mobile platforms.
October 2025 (2025-10) — Delivered deployment reliability improvements, CDN-based asset delivery, and new UI capabilities across the TD Design family. The work spanned Flutter, Vue, React, MiniProgram, and API components, with a focus on business value through reliable previews, scalable production asset delivery, and improved developer experience via docs and deployment config updates. Major outcomes include stabilizing the preview deployment workflow, introducing interactive UI primitives, and standardizing production asset paths across web and mobile platforms.
September 2025 performance summary highlighting delivery of key features, bug fixes, and cross-repo improvements across Tencent/tdesign ecosystems. The month focused on strengthening deployment reliability, improving UI/UX consistency, and expanding icon capabilities, while ensuring form, skeleton, and dialog components behave correctly across frameworks. The work delivered business value by enabling faster deployment, richer iconography, and more robust cross-framework components, with demonstrable improvements in accessibility, performance, and developer experience.
September 2025 performance summary highlighting delivery of key features, bug fixes, and cross-repo improvements across Tencent/tdesign ecosystems. The month focused on strengthening deployment reliability, improving UI/UX consistency, and expanding icon capabilities, while ensuring form, skeleton, and dialog components behave correctly across frameworks. The work delivered business value by enabling faster deployment, richer iconography, and more robust cross-framework components, with demonstrable improvements in accessibility, performance, and developer experience.
August 2025 monthly summary highlighting feature deliveries, stability fixes, and cross-repo improvements across Tencent/tdesign family. The month focused on enhancing user-facing components, stabilizing rendering paths, and improving developer experience through refactors and clearer release processes. Business value was delivered via richer data-entry experiences, safer and more predictable form handling, more robust date/time handling, and streamlined maintenance for long-term reliability across React, Vue, and Web components ecosystems.
August 2025 monthly summary highlighting feature deliveries, stability fixes, and cross-repo improvements across Tencent/tdesign family. The month focused on enhancing user-facing components, stabilizing rendering paths, and improving developer experience through refactors and clearer release processes. Business value was delivered via richer data-entry experiences, safer and more predictable form handling, more robust date/time handling, and streamlined maintenance for long-term reliability across React, Vue, and Web components ecosystems.
July 2025 highlights across Tencent/tdesign and related repositories. Delivered cross-repo features and stability fixes with a strong emphasis on design-system consistency, localization readiness, and release readiness. Key outcomes include expanded component APIs, improved live docs and demos, and enhanced UI reliability, contributing to faster deployments and higher product quality.
July 2025 highlights across Tencent/tdesign and related repositories. Delivered cross-repo features and stability fixes with a strong emphasis on design-system consistency, localization readiness, and release readiness. Key outcomes include expanded component APIs, improved live docs and demos, and enhanced UI reliability, contributing to faster deployments and higher product quality.
June 2025 performance snapshot for Tencent design system libraries (tdesign): Focused on delivering modular, production-ready features, stabilizing release/build pipelines, and elevating developer and user experience across Vue and React components. The month saw ESM-enabled builds for chat components, targeted UI bug fixes, and enhancements to release processes and documentation. This collectively improved load performance, reliability, and onboarding for contributors while ensuring consistent, scalable design-system usage in production.
June 2025 performance snapshot for Tencent design system libraries (tdesign): Focused on delivering modular, production-ready features, stabilizing release/build pipelines, and elevating developer and user experience across Vue and React components. The month saw ESM-enabled builds for chat components, targeted UI bug fixes, and enhancements to release processes and documentation. This collectively improved load performance, reliability, and onboarding for contributors while ensuring consistent, scalable design-system usage in production.
May 2025 performance snapshot across Tencent/tdesign family focused on delivering business value through localization, release readiness, reliability, and developer experience enhancements. Highlights include multilingual upload experience, stable release governance, robust CI workflows, and cross-platform documentation and component improvements. These efforts improved user-facing UX, reduced release risk, and strengthened platform-wide consistency for developers and partners.
May 2025 performance snapshot across Tencent/tdesign family focused on delivering business value through localization, release readiness, reliability, and developer experience enhancements. Highlights include multilingual upload experience, stable release governance, robust CI workflows, and cross-platform documentation and component improvements. These efforts improved user-facing UX, reduced release risk, and strengthened platform-wide consistency for developers and partners.
April 2025 performance highlights across the Tencent/tdesign family: delivered user-centric features and stability improvements across React, Vue Next, and API packages, including a clear action for the Date Range Picker, Swiper cardScale API, and open-source chat component release for Vue Next. Implemented targeted bug fixes that improve UX and reliability for ImageViewer, Table, Tree, and Select components. Completed comprehensive build tooling and project housekeeping to enhance maintainability, build reliability, and CI readiness. Coordinated release cycles and documentation updates across multiple repos, strengthening developer experience and accelerating adoption of design-system components. Demonstrated strong proficiency with TypeScript typings, modern tooling (Rollup, Vite), and cross-project collaboration.
April 2025 performance highlights across the Tencent/tdesign family: delivered user-centric features and stability improvements across React, Vue Next, and API packages, including a clear action for the Date Range Picker, Swiper cardScale API, and open-source chat component release for Vue Next. Implemented targeted bug fixes that improve UX and reliability for ImageViewer, Table, Tree, and Select components. Completed comprehensive build tooling and project housekeeping to enhance maintainability, build reliability, and CI readiness. Coordinated release cycles and documentation updates across multiple repos, strengthening developer experience and accelerating adoption of design-system components. Demonstrated strong proficiency with TypeScript typings, modern tooling (Rollup, Vite), and cross-project collaboration.
March 2025 performance highlights across the Tencent/tdesign family: delivered high-impact features and critical fixes across Vue/NPM packages, strengthening build reliability, cross-framework compatibility, and developer experience while advancing internationalization and design-system maintainability. Key business outcomes include reduced build-time failures due to CJS/ESM bundling issues, expanded API surfaces for programmatic UI control, and improved release readiness with CI improvements.
March 2025 performance highlights across the Tencent/tdesign family: delivered high-impact features and critical fixes across Vue/NPM packages, strengthening build reliability, cross-framework compatibility, and developer experience while advancing internationalization and design-system maintainability. Key business outcomes include reduced build-time failures due to CJS/ESM bundling issues, expanded API surfaces for programmatic UI control, and improved release readiness with CI improvements.
February 2025 performance snapshot: Across Tencent/tdesign-family, the team delivered foundational utilities, UX refinements, and release-ready build improvements that reduce maintenance risk and accelerate feature delivery. key outcomes include new utilities and UI style refactors, targeted bug fixes, and robust documentation and release workflows across React and Vue ecosystems.
February 2025 performance snapshot: Across Tencent/tdesign-family, the team delivered foundational utilities, UX refinements, and release-ready build improvements that reduce maintenance risk and accelerate feature delivery. key outcomes include new utilities and UI style refactors, targeted bug fixes, and robust documentation and release workflows across React and Vue ecosystems.
January 2025 performance summary across TDesign repos. Focused on delivering developer-facing API enhancements, accessibility improvements, and documentation quality to accelerate adoption and reduce support overhead, while maintaining codebase health across React, Vue, Vue Next, mini-program, and API projects. Key features and fixes include: 1) ImageProps API for Upload with clarified documentation in tdesign-api; 2) ArrowLeft/ArrowRight differentiation groundwork added to keyboard handling in tdesign-common; 3) Data integrity and keyboard accessibility fixes for the Table component in tdesign-vue, plus a major 1.10.9 release with AutoComplete and DatePicker enhancements; 4) GlobEager restoration, table navigation fixes, and AI-powered documentation search updates in tdesign-vue-next, plus multi-date support in DatePicker; 5) Codebase cleanup and maintainability improvements in tdesign-react; README/documentation consistency improvements in tdesign-miniprogram. Overall impact: higher developer productivity, fewer edge-case bugs, more accessible UIs, and clearer onboarding through improved docs and search capabilities. Technologies demonstrated: API design and integration, keyboard accessibility, release engineering, AI-assisted documentation, and cross-repo maintenance.
January 2025 performance summary across TDesign repos. Focused on delivering developer-facing API enhancements, accessibility improvements, and documentation quality to accelerate adoption and reduce support overhead, while maintaining codebase health across React, Vue, Vue Next, mini-program, and API projects. Key features and fixes include: 1) ImageProps API for Upload with clarified documentation in tdesign-api; 2) ArrowLeft/ArrowRight differentiation groundwork added to keyboard handling in tdesign-common; 3) Data integrity and keyboard accessibility fixes for the Table component in tdesign-vue, plus a major 1.10.9 release with AutoComplete and DatePicker enhancements; 4) GlobEager restoration, table navigation fixes, and AI-powered documentation search updates in tdesign-vue-next, plus multi-date support in DatePicker; 5) Codebase cleanup and maintainability improvements in tdesign-react; README/documentation consistency improvements in tdesign-miniprogram. Overall impact: higher developer productivity, fewer edge-case bugs, more accessible UIs, and clearer onboarding through improved docs and search capabilities. Technologies demonstrated: API design and integration, keyboard accessibility, release engineering, AI-assisted documentation, and cross-repo maintenance.
December 2024 performance highlights across Tencent/tdesign ecosystems (React, Vue, Vue Next, and Miniprogram) focused on usability, reliability, and cross-framework consistency. Key UX improvements delivered for core components, plus scalability features for large data sets, and foundational configuration work to enable future enhancements. The month also saw targeted bug fixes across several repos to stabilize interactions and rendering across frameworks.
December 2024 performance highlights across Tencent/tdesign ecosystems (React, Vue, Vue Next, and Miniprogram) focused on usability, reliability, and cross-framework consistency. Key UX improvements delivered for core components, plus scalability features for large data sets, and foundational configuration work to enable future enhancements. The month also saw targeted bug fixes across several repos to stabilize interactions and rendering across frameworks.
November 2024 — Across the Tencent/tdesign family and related repos, delivered measurable business value through robust release automation, cross-framework UI improvements, UX refinements, and accessibility improvements. The month featured coordinated feature work, stability fixes, and documentation updates that reduce release toil, improve user experience, and strengthen security posture. Key features delivered: - Release and Version Management Enhancements in Tencent/tdesign: improved release automation reliability and accuracy of package version fetching and release metadata, including fixes for auto-release timing, version requests, request filtering, API/release version handling, and the official release of v0.15.5. - DatePicker enhancements in TDesignOteam/tdesign-api: add disableTime API across React, Vue Next, and Vue to disable specific hours/minutes/seconds; support multi-date selection via array values; updated docs and type definitions. - Menu/Anchor UX improvements in TDesignOteam APIs: tooltipProps for Menu across React, Vue, and Vue-next for richer Tooltip integration; customScroll and getCurrentAnchor support for Anchor to enable custom scrolling and highlight logic. - Cascader UX improvements across td designs: close panel on item click when trigger is hover (tdesign-react and tdesign-vue-next) for faster, intuitive navigation; improved hover-based interactions. - UI/UX, icons, and accessibility upgrades: icon library upgrades and tdesign-site-components patches; new tooltipProps API on MenuItem; accessibility enhancement via checkbox title property; semantic versioning adoption for clearer versioning and docs. Major impact: - Reduced release toil through enhanced automation and reliable version metadata, accelerating go-to-market timelines. - Enhanced user experience in navigation components (Menu, Cascader, Anchor) and richer iconography across React and Vue ecosystems. - Improved accessibility and documentation, plus stronger security posture via dependency vulnerability remediation. Technologies and skills demonstrated: - Cross-framework proficiency (React, Vue, Vue Next) and TypeScript typings; API design and doc updates. - Release automation, registry handling, and semantic versioning. - UX enhancements, localization-ready documentation, and accessibility improvements. - Security awareness with dependency vulnerability remediation across core repos.
November 2024 — Across the Tencent/tdesign family and related repos, delivered measurable business value through robust release automation, cross-framework UI improvements, UX refinements, and accessibility improvements. The month featured coordinated feature work, stability fixes, and documentation updates that reduce release toil, improve user experience, and strengthen security posture. Key features delivered: - Release and Version Management Enhancements in Tencent/tdesign: improved release automation reliability and accuracy of package version fetching and release metadata, including fixes for auto-release timing, version requests, request filtering, API/release version handling, and the official release of v0.15.5. - DatePicker enhancements in TDesignOteam/tdesign-api: add disableTime API across React, Vue Next, and Vue to disable specific hours/minutes/seconds; support multi-date selection via array values; updated docs and type definitions. - Menu/Anchor UX improvements in TDesignOteam APIs: tooltipProps for Menu across React, Vue, and Vue-next for richer Tooltip integration; customScroll and getCurrentAnchor support for Anchor to enable custom scrolling and highlight logic. - Cascader UX improvements across td designs: close panel on item click when trigger is hover (tdesign-react and tdesign-vue-next) for faster, intuitive navigation; improved hover-based interactions. - UI/UX, icons, and accessibility upgrades: icon library upgrades and tdesign-site-components patches; new tooltipProps API on MenuItem; accessibility enhancement via checkbox title property; semantic versioning adoption for clearer versioning and docs. Major impact: - Reduced release toil through enhanced automation and reliable version metadata, accelerating go-to-market timelines. - Enhanced user experience in navigation components (Menu, Cascader, Anchor) and richer iconography across React and Vue ecosystems. - Improved accessibility and documentation, plus stronger security posture via dependency vulnerability remediation. Technologies and skills demonstrated: - Cross-framework proficiency (React, Vue, Vue Next) and TypeScript typings; API design and doc updates. - Release automation, registry handling, and semantic versioning. - UX enhancements, localization-ready documentation, and accessibility improvements. - Security awareness with dependency vulnerability remediation across core repos.
October 2024 monthly summary for Tencent/tdesign-react focused on stabilizing the library and preparing a reliable release. No new features shipped this month; priority was cross-component bug fixes to improve reliability and downstream support. The release process was completed for version 1.9.3, consolidating quality improvements into a well-documented, maintainable baseline.
October 2024 monthly summary for Tencent/tdesign-react focused on stabilizing the library and preparing a reliable release. No new features shipped this month; priority was cross-component bug fixes to improve reliability and downstream support. The release process was completed for version 1.9.3, consolidating quality improvements into a well-documented, maintainable baseline.
Overview of all repositories you've contributed to across your timeline